NAME

Paws::SESv2::Template

USAGE

This class represents one of two things:

Arguments in a call to a service

Use the attributes of this class as arguments to methods. You shouldn't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the calls that expect this type of object.

As an example, if Att1 is expected to be a Paws::SESv2::Template object:

  $service_obj->Method(Att1 => { TemplateArn => $value, ..., TemplateName => $value  });

Results returned from an API call

Use accessors for each attribute. If Att1 is expected to be an Paws::SESv2::Template object:

  $result = $service_obj->Method(...);
  $result->Att1->TemplateArn

DESCRIPTION

An object that defines the email template to use for an email message, and the values to use for any message variables in that template. An email template is a type of message template that contains content that you want to define, save, and reuse in email messages that you send.

ATTRIBUTES

TemplateArn => Str

The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the template.

TemplateData => Str

An object that defines the values to use for message variables in the template. This object is a set of key-value pairs. Each key defines a message variable in the template. The corresponding value defines the value to use for that variable.

TemplateName => Str

The name of the template. You will refer to this name when you send email using the SendTemplatedEmail or SendBulkTemplatedEmail operations.
